少儿编程比赛程序是什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    少儿编程比赛程序指的是少儿参与编程比赛时所编写的程序。编程比赛是指通过一系列的编程作品和项目来展示个人编程能力和创造力的竞赛活动。在少儿编程比赛中,参赛选手需要根据比赛规则和要求,利用计算机编程语言(如Scratch、Python、Java等)编写程序来完成指定的任务或解决特定的问题。

    编程比赛程序的内容可以包含各种算法、逻辑运算、循环结构和函数等编程基础知识和技巧。它们可以用于实现各种功能,如数学计算、图像处理、游戏开发、数据分析等。具体要求根据不同的比赛项目和级别而有所不同。有些比赛可能要求参赛选手编写一款游戏或应用程序,有些可能要求解决特定的难题或设计一个算法,还有些可以自由发挥,创造自己的编程作品。

    在编写比赛程序时,选手需要具备良好的逻辑思维能力和编程技巧。他们需要能够分析问题,设计解决方案,并将其转化为实际可运行的代码。同时,他们还需要考虑代码的效率和可读性,以及如何优化程序的性能和功能实现。

    参与少儿编程比赛对学生的编程能力和创造力提出了挑战,同时也提供了锻炼和展示自己的机会。通过参加编程比赛,学生可以提高编程技能,培养创新思维和团队合作精神。此外,获得编程比赛的奖项和认可,还可以为学生的学术和职业发展增添亮点。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    少儿编程比赛程序是指在少儿编程比赛中,学生需根据规定的题目和要求,使用编程语言编写程序解决问题的过程和结果。以下是关于少儿编程比赛程序的相关内容:

    1. 编程语言选择:少儿编程比赛通常要求学生使用特定的编程语言进行编程,如Scratch、Python、Java等。根据比赛组别和难度级别的不同,编程语言的选取会有所区别。

    2. 题目和要求:每个比赛项目都会有具体的题目和要求。这些题目可能是具体实际问题的模拟,也可能是要求学生设计特定的程序,实现一定的功能或逻辑。题目可能涉及到数学问题、图形化编程、游戏设计等等。

    3. 程序设计:参赛学生根据题目要求,利用编程语言进行程序设计。程序设计包括算法设计、代码实现和调试。学生需要考虑如何运用编程语言的各种语法和功能,实现题目要求中的特定功能,并保证程序的正确性和有效性。

    4. 提交和评审:学生在规定的时间内完成编写程序后,将程序提交给评审团队。评审团队会对提交的程序进行评审,评分标准通常包括程序的功能完整性、代码的可读性和规范性、程序的执行效率等等。

    5. 比赛成绩和排名:评审团队根据程序评分结果,对参赛选手进行成绩和排名的统计。通常会设立多个奖项,对表现出色的参赛选手进行奖励和表彰。

    通过参加少儿编程比赛,学生不仅可以展示自己的编程技能,还可以提高解决问题和创造性思维的能力。此外,比赛还可以促进学习者之间的交流与分享,共同进步。因此,少儿编程比赛程序对学生的综合素质提升和编程能力的培养具有重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    少儿编程比赛程序是指在少儿编程竞赛中参赛选手们所编写的计算机程序。这些程序通常基于编程语言或编程平台,经过精心设计和编写,实现各种功能和任务。编程比赛程序的目的是让少年儿童通过编程的实践,提升他们的计算机科学和编程技能,并在比赛中展示自己的创造力和解决问题的能力。

    编程比赛程序通常需要完成特定的任务或解决问题。这些任务可以包括编写算法来解决数学问题、设计游戏、创建动画、控制机器人等。程序的目标可能是实现特定的功能或达到特定的要求,例如计算出特定的数字、判断输入是否符合要求、实现游戏的规则等等。

    编程比赛程序的实现主要依赖于编程语言和工具。常见的编程语言包括Scratch、Python、Java、C++等,这些编程语言具有不同的特点和应用场景,选手需要根据比赛要求选择合适的语言来编写程序。此外,还可以使用编程平台,如Arduino、Raspberry Pi等硬件平台,来实现物理交互和控制。

    编写编程比赛程序的流程通常包括以下步骤:

    1. 确定比赛任务和要求:明确比赛的任务和要求,了解比赛规则和评分标准。

    2. 设计程序逻辑:根据任务和要求,设计程序的逻辑,确定所需的输入和输出,思考解决问题的方法和算法。

    3. 编写代码:使用选定的编程语言,根据设计好的逻辑和算法,编写具体的代码。代码需要符合编程语言的语法规则,同时需要考虑代码的性能和可读性。

    4. 测试和调试:对编写的程序进行测试,检查程序的功能是否正常,是否满足比赛要求。如果发现问题,需要进行调试和修改。

    5. 优化和改进:针对程序的性能和功能,进行优化和改进,提高程序的效率和可扩展性。

    6. 提交作品:将编写完成的程序提交给比赛组织方,参加比赛评比。

    在编程比赛过程中,选手们需要展现编程思维和解决问题的能力。他们需要通过分析问题、设计算法和实现代码,来解决具体的编程任务。比赛的评判通常基于程序的功能完整性、正确性、效率和创新性等方面进行评估。选手们可以通过参加编程比赛,提高自己的编程技能,培养创造力和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部